You are confusing personalities with gimmicks. Rollins character does have a personality
He has a superiority complex, he seeks other wrestlers approval. He's cocky, he's arrogant and he has an ego that gets him in to trouble. He acts entitled, he hides behind other people when it benefits him but again his ego can hinder that. He realises despite his superiority complex that he can't go toe to toe with some people so he cowers and uses whatever help he can get.
That is a personality.
Referring to yourself in 3rd person and dropping a crowd pandering line, making fire shoot out of the arena and being carried to the crowd in a coffin because you're an undead zombie with supernatural powers is not a bunch of personality traits. That is a gimmick/gimmicks
Somebody like Taker (dead man) is bland as shit. He doesn't display 1/10th of the personality traits somebody like Rollins does.
I am the undertaker, you WILL Rest In Peace. Lol.

+1. I don't know why the hell they broke them up. Harper and Rowan got back together again last month and I hoped that was a sign of a full reunion but then Rowan got a 6 month injury smh.
And the problem with Bray imo is 100% booking. He cuts these amazing promos and vows to do some legit stuff and he does not end up backing his words.
Promises to end the legacy of Cena, expose his lies etc. CenaWinsLol.
Talks about his tough childhood and how the WWE World title will be his salvation. Loses.
Looks like a monster in the Royal Rumble, dominates everyone. Big Show and Kane throw him out so super Reigns looks strong when eliminating them.
Proclaims himself the new face of fear and vows to take the torch from Undertaker. Loses to Undertaker.
